Parents and teachers should care about letter recognition of uppercase letters for 4-year-olds because it is a foundational skill crucial for early literacy development. Recognizing uppercase letters lays the groundwork for a child's ability to read and write, essential skills for academic success. At this age, children’s brains are exceptionally receptive to learning new concepts, including the shape, form, and sound of letters.
Being able to identify uppercase letters helps children with phonemic awareness, allowing them to connect sounds with symbols. This early decoding skill is indispensable for future reading fluency. Furthermore, as teachers and parents introduce these letters, children develop important cognitive skills such as memory, visual discrimination, and attention to detail.
Moreover, letter recognition fosters a sense of confidence and enthusiasm about learning. When children can identify letters, they feel accomplished and capable, motivating them to take on more challenging tasks with a positive attitude.
For parents, engaging in letter recognition activities can create bonding opportunities that make learning feel like a shared, enjoyable adventure. For teachers, focusing on uppercase letters can serve as a manageable first step before introducing lowercase letters, ensuring a comprehensive literacy curriculum.
Overall, understanding uppercase letters is an important milestone that catalyzes a child’s journey towards becoming a proficient reader and lifelong learner.
